Handover Note – Project Lanternfall

From: Director C. Mabrey. To: Director H. Quill.

We are evaluating the acquisition of Brindlecote Systems, a mid-sized analytics firm based in Esterwick. Initial diligence shows stable revenue but thin margins. Valuation range and deal structure are still open; finance has the working model. Advisors are engaged and the data room opens Monday. The confidential note on business plans is appended directly below.

board note of kaduf-yagag: Sorvanax Foods is in early talks to buy Holiusix Systems for about $409.8 million. The Quenwyn launch date is May 26, and nothing goes to the press before then. Legal wants the Gormirax Foods term sheet withdrawn before October 24.

# Environment Variables — Consent Banner Rollout

Applies to all Brindlecore plugins targeting the v3 banner. Set `BANNER_REGION` to the market code. Set `BANNER_MODE` to `staged` or `full`. Plugins must not render consent UI themselves; call the banner API instead. Rollout percentage is controlled server-side — do not override it locally. Cache TTL defaults to 300 seconds and rarely needs changing. The banner API rejects unauthenticated calls, so your plugin's env file must include the signing credential on the next line:

vault entry, yahif-yajep: COURIER_KEY29=b802bdf8034096b65a51c6ba5abe2

## Authentication

Dark-mode assets for the Quillboard admin dashboard are served from the internal Themery service, which requires an authenticated fetch at build time. The release pipeline reads the key from the `THEMERY_AUTH` environment variable before packaging. For the release build, configure that variable with the key provided here.

app token of bahaf-tajeg = zpat23_SjjsllwiLmXbtS65veZaV47

**Quarterly Planning Note**

Legacy Quillbase customers move to new pricing in Q3: 12% uplift, grandfathered discounts end. Expect churn of 4–6%, net revenue still positive. Comms go out six weeks ahead. Support scripts are ready; Delia's team handles escalations. No exceptions without sign-off. Review the confidential item below before your first pricing call.

confidential, kagup-bafog: Fraaxax Group is in early talks to buy Soroxox Group for about $343.8 million. The Olidor launch date is June 14, and nothing goes to the press before then. Legal wants the Aldmirek Logistics term sheet signed before July 23.